The IR Hunter uses its processing power to deliver precision sighting
reticles. These reticles scale as you zoom the same as a first focal
plane reticle does on a high end rifle scope! Each IR Hunter comes
programed with three different reticles for the shooter to choose from:
Thermal Combat Reticle (TCR), Thermal Dot Reticle (TDR), and Thermal
Subtension Reticle (TSR).
Another interesting feature found in the IR Hunter is Enhanced Target
Recognition (ETR). Thermal systems work very well at night, but there
are situations where they have difficulty. When the horizon or sky is
behind a target is one of the classic examples of this. With the ETR
mode, the entire gain settings for the thermal sensor are applied to the
target area inside the yellow box, giving you a perfect image inside
the ETR window.
The IR Hunter has a unique system for focusing the DFC
Digital Focus Control feature. This allows you to focus the system and
its image enhancing processing, it takes your normal thermal image to
the nest level; making a 320×240 look like a 640×480 system.
With most thermal sights, you have a white hot and black hot polarity
mode which can be switched back and forth to find the best image. The
IR Hunter features the new MaxPol Multiple Polarity Control mode that
gives you 3 levels of white and 3 levels of black hot so you can get the
best image in both!
